REVIEW: Love Me Stalk Me by Laura Bishop

Posted January 28th, 2026 by in Blog, Contemporary Romance, Dark Romance, Review / 4 comments

Love Me Stalk Me by Laura Bishop: Izzy Russo downloads an AI boyfriend app to vent her fantasies, never imagining that the “AI” she’s confiding in isn’t artificial at all — it’s Cal Knight, the broody, tattooed head of security at her job. Overworked, exhausted, and secretly craving attention, Izzy has no idea that every thought, every confession, has been listened to, studied, and turned into a plan by someone who’s convinced she’s meant to be his.

When her world starts to unravel and danger creeps closer, Cal is ready to step in — protective, possessive, and completely obsessed. What starts as a darkly playful setup quickly becomes a tense, thrilling romance about boundaries, desire, and how far someone will go for the person they can’t let go of.

I enjoyed LOVE ME, STALK ME by Laura Bishop for how it balances dark romance with humor and sharp emotional stakes. Izzy’s vulnerability and Cal’s obsessive intensity are matched with sizzling chemistry that is both thrilling and unsettling. It’s not a slow-burn romance — it’s fast, fiery, and full of moments that make you gasp, laugh, and sit up a little straighter. The romance here is raw and tense— even when it’s morally gray and borderline reckless.

LOVE ME, STALK ME is bold, high-tension, and uncomfortably addictive — the kind of dark romance you can’t put down and can’t stop thinking about. This book is perfect for readers who love high-tension, morally gray romances, obsessive love stories, and darkly flirty dynamics with a modern AI twist.

Book Info:

Publication: Published: December 2, 2025 | Atria Books | Series: Obsessively Yours

When overworked department store manager Izzy Russo downloads an AI boyfriend app to fill the emotional void left by her inattentive real one, she thinks she’s just venting to a harmless chatbot named “Caleb.” In reality, she’s been pouring her deepest, dirtiest fantasies into the ears of Callahan Knight—her store’s brooding new head of security.

Because Cal? He’s been listening. The moment he saw Izzy, he knew she was his. Did he hack her phone? Absolutely. But who could blame him? A woman like Izzy deserves to be cherished by someone who truly knows her worth—and he’ll do anything to be that man.

So when Izzy finally sees her boyfriend for who he really is, and the danger she’s unknowingly been caught up in, Cal is ready to protect her, no matter the cost. Even if it means revealing the truth.

She might not have meant to build the perfect man. But he’s here now. And he’s never letting her go.
